For Mary, the YMCA is a place where people are encouraged to try, grow, and belong.
In this episode of The Story Place, Mary reflects on her journey from a hesitant first-time participant to a dedicated member, volunteer, and advocate for the Y's mission. She shares how the encouragement of others helped her discover confidence, why community matters at every stage of life, and the important role the Y plays in addressing social isolation, especially among older adults.
Mary also offers a unique perspective on philanthropy and why investing in the YMCA is really about investing in people. From teaching every child to swim to creating opportunities for teens, families, and seniors, she shares the vision that continues to inspire her commitment to the Y.
It's a conversation about connection, purpose, and the power of a community that refuses to let people disappear.
